- What is Signet Jewelers's change in income taxes?
- Signet Jewelers (SIG) reported change in income taxes of -$34.3M in Q1 2026.
- How has Signet Jewelers's change in income taxes changed year-over-year?
- Signet Jewelers's change in income taxes decreased by 357.3% year-over-year, from -$7.5M to -$34.3M.
- What does change in income taxes mean?
- Change in income tax receivables and payables, reflecting timing between tax accruals and cash payments.
